Even before the first trailer hit the internet. It was a very ambitious movie project, completely financed by independent production companies as well as a significant part of internet crowdfunding. It is a movie that follows the paths of a traditional b-movie. But is it a good or bad b-movie?<\/p>\n<p>The story is pretty simple and if you&#8217;re reading this, I don&#8217;t think I have to explain a lot. It&#8217;s basically about Nazi&#8217;s who found a hideout on the dark side of the moon. There they managed to build a society and follow their traditions. One of the traditions is, of course, to take over the planet. Planet Earth of course. So there is a long time plan on the move, to take over good old mother Earth. In the movie the USA are closing in on an election. Madame president (who does look a little like Sarah Palin) sent a 2 man team to the moon to take some nice pictures that shall help her to win the election. One of the guys is a model. A good looking guy&#8230; a black guy. He discoveres the Nazi base and gets arrested by them. He&#8217;s one of the protagonists we follow. The more he sees what&#8217;s going on, he wants to cross the evil plans, the Nazis are ready to execute. That starts a string of happenings and hijinks.<\/p>\n<p>Now the first thing you can do wrong is to go into the movie with A: expectations &#038; B: being easily offended by jokes that are politically incorrect. Some of the jokes are quite forced. Others require you to have some education to understand them. So it&#8217;s a weird mix of poor and quality jokes in there. Also the dialogue feels a little clunky at times. On the other hand we have actually a nice cast, that tries to get the best off of the stuff they got to work with.<\/p>\n<p>One more thing is that the movie tries a little too hard to bring out a message. And my guess is that the message is something like: &#8220;when it comes down to greed and surviving&#8230; there will be no difference between a Nazi or anyone else&#8221; or &#8220;as long as we have the same enemy we will work together, but afterwards it will only take us a split second to find ourselfes new ones or even turn against former allies&#8221;.<\/p>\n<p>Some might argue that a roughly 8 million dollar budget is a lot of money. But looking at the visual quality this movie has, it&#8217;s quite a remarkable job. The battle scenes in space look great. A lot of CG work in general. And all of it looks pretty neat! They also work with a ton of greenscreen sets. And yes, you can see it. Nonetheless it&#8217;s important to say that it really works in the context of the production. Much like a 60mil dollar &#8216;Sky captain and the world of tomorrow&#8217; from 2004. It&#8217;s crazy how far CG production came in these 8 years. Will be interesting to see what other people might come up with. Now that the possibilities are there and easier to handle.<\/p>\n<p>So my final verdict is that I tend to say that it is a legitimate good movie. You can see that the production really put some heart, sweat and effort into it all. And that is what divides a good b-movie from a bad one. All the missing elements of a big budget movie, that a b-movie obviously has, can be filled with heart and effort. And that is what you can see in this film. Yes it is clunky and cheesy&#8230; but hey it&#8217;s also a lot of fun. And that&#8217;s what the producers want you to have.
